Following the success of our sponsored bike ride in 2007, Médecins du Monde UK (MdM UK) is calling for more adventurous cyclists to sign up for the third London to Paris Bike Ride 2008. This incredible three-day challenge covers almost 300 kilometres of hilly - but stunningly colourful - terrain.
MDM UK send volunteers overseas to provide medical care to vulnerable people who are effected by natural disasters (recent earthquake in Peru), conflict (emergency mission sent to Iraq) and extreme poverty (HIV/AIDS prevent amongst the slum dwellers in Cambodia). For the Bike Ride challenge, the team meets in London on the first morning, then cycles to the coast to catch a ferry from Newhaven to Dieppe. MdM UK’s London to Paris Bike Ride will leave London on Saturday 12 July, arriving at the Eiffel Tower in Paris by late afternoon on Monday 14 July in time for the amazing Bastille Day celebrations in France’s magical capital city. Cyclists can rest their tired legs on Tuesday 15 July, sightsee or visit MdM's Parisian offices. The return journey is by Eurostar on Tuesday afternoon. Participants must pay a non-refundable £99 Registration Fee, then pledge to raise £1,000 in sponsorship funds. Many thanks ! |
